释义与例句

n.
  1. 1.

    A kind of tree, the arborvitae; an individual thereof.

  2. 2.

    A metaphor used to describe the phylogenetic relationships between organisms, both living and extinct; a diagram that shows those relationships, with a treelike appearance.

    生物
  3. 3.

    A term used in the Hebrew Bible that is a component of the world tree motif.

    宗教
  4. 4.

    The central mystical symbol used in the Kabbalah of esoteric Judaism, also known as the ten sephiroth.
